STATE v. CASTANEDA

No. 1 CA-CR 02-0066.

102 P.3d 985 (2004)

209 Ariz. 366

STATE of Arizona, Appellee, v. Joel CASTANEDA, Appellant.

Court of Appeals of Arizona, Division 1, Department C.

December 21, 2004.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Terry Goddard, Attorney General, By Randall M. Howe, Chief Counsel, Criminal Appeals Section and Eric J. Olsson, Assistant Attorney General, Diane L. Hunt, Assistant Attorney General, Tucson, Attorneys for Appellee.

James J. Haas, Maricopa County Public Defender, By Spencer D. Heffel, Deputy Public Defender, Phoenix, Attorneys for Appellant.


OPINION

LANKFORD, Judge.

¶ 1 This appeal returns to us on remand from the Supreme Court of Arizona. The supreme court remanded for us to reconsider our prior memorandum decision in light of its opinion in State v. Sepahi, 206 Ariz. 321, 78 P.3d 732 (2003). After further review, we vacate that part of our previous decision that addressed the issue on which the supreme court...
